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
07165590162 66 0264066028
6332225 418476260 57
6332225 418476260 57
52278369559 88 329740
All about undefined
Interested in learning more?
6332225 418476260 57
52278369559 88 329740
See more
93145 62268
628 2503368 897 47615
See more
62659 25462850 8324165390
3850 039 92382404909 831008646 65591916
See more